Fear the Walking Dead” Season 2 brought a lot of action last week as it saw the crew of the Abigail discover what happens when they try to take on more survivors, as well as offering a little more insight into their unofficial captain. In episode 4 of the AMC drama, titled “Blood in the Streets,” that will continue as they deal with pushier survivors and a more enigmatic Victor Strand.

The character, played by Colman Domingo, has been nothing but a mystery since his introduction at the end of Season 1. It was revealed in episode 3 that he plans to take the survivors to a self-sustaining compound in Mexico, that’s apparently got a very exclusive guest list — assuming it exists at all, of course. Despite no one asking him more questions about this very elaborate-sounding safe haven, it seems fans will figure out a lot more in the upcoming episode.

According to the official plot synopsis, when Nick (Frank Dillane) gets word of an associate of Strand’s they will split off from the rest of the group on separate missions as more of the character’s past is revealed. It’s unclear what exactly Nick’s role in all this will be, but the below teaser clip from next week’s episode indicates that he’ll make his way back to land, and subsequently civilization. With a make-shift wall in place along the coast and a fleet of ships and helicopters patrolling the area, it seems there’s far more of a militarized presence left in the world than previously thought.

Meanwhile, the remaining survivors aboard the Abigail will have to encounter survivors that are, for the first time in their journey, unavoidable. In last week’s episode, the group encountered Charlie (Michelle Ang) and Jake (Brendan Meyer) from “Fear the Walking Dead: Flight 462.” However, [SPOILER ALERT] they discovered that Strand’s destination barely has room for Madison (Kim Dickens) and her family, let alone two strangers. After mercilessly cutting them loose, it seems this week Abigail will be boarded by another group, with less-than-noble intentions.

Both of these storylines are teased heavily in the episode’s teaser trailer, which seems to indicate that the people they let on board the yacht have plans to take it from them. Not only does the group appear to be compiling their weapons and ammo together, but Chris (Lorenzo James Henrie) and Travis (Cliff Curtis) find themselves tied up on deck trying to get convince their would-be executors not to execute them.

With Strand’s grand plan becoming clearer and clearer and the rest of the group learning the hard way that the cannot save everyone, it seems everything that “Fear the Walking Dead” Season 2 has been building toward will come to a head on Sunday, May 1, at 9 p.m. EDT.
